evazion c2e6202da6 Fix #4920: Wrong color for certain samples.
The problem was that we were stripping color profiles from thumbnails,
but we weren't setting `export_profile: "srgb"` to convert images to
sRGB first. This resulted in wrong colors for images with non-sRGB color
profiles, such as Adobe RGB.

The fix is to convert images to sRGB when possible, while leaving CMYK
and greyscale images alone. We leave CMYK images alone because we can't
convert CMYK to sRGB without losing color. We leave greyscale images
alone if they don't have a color profile, that way they stay as
one-channel greyscale (or two-channel greyscale, in case of alpha)
instead of being converted to three-channel sRGB. However, if a
greyscale image has a color profile, then we have to convert to sRGB,
otherwise the colors would be wrong when we strip the profile.

We also have to set the import profile, otherwise images with broken
embedded color profiles won't have a fallback profile and may get
incorrect colors. In this case we also have to be careful, because we
can't specify an sRGB fallback for greyscale or CMYK images.
